Kitchen Assistant – Crowthorne Premium Pub + Tips + 70% off meals + Consistent hours, Times Top 100 employer Beautiful New Pub Restaurant – Vibrant and Green Part of the Hall & Woodhouse family H&W Crowthorne is a sensational new multi-million pound restaurant and bar. With an innovative and sustainable two-storey design the pub forms the gateway to the Bucklers park residential development and surrounding Bucklers Forest. Comprising five different multi-functioning spaces for guests to enjoy including a dedicated bar, a pantry/caf for coffee and cakes through to relaxed dining and drinks, a vibrant dining space, an extensive outdoor terrace, and a large attractive garden. Taking inspiration from its surroundings; plants, stylistic artwork, colourful soft furnishings, and exposed brick walls feature to create a contemporary interior style. With a warm feel and lots of colourful character guests can relax in the perfect setting with great food and delicious Badger beers, whatever the occasion.
